Understanding Auto Insurance Estimates
When seeking auto insurance quotes in Burnet County, TX, you’ll encounter terms like car insurance estimates, rate quotes, and premium estimations. Understanding these terms is crucial for making informed decisions about your auto insurance policy. Here’s a detailed overview of these key concepts:
- Car Insurance Estimates: These preliminary calculations are tailored to your specific circumstances. They take into account factors like your driving history, vehicle make and model, and your desired coverage levels. For example, if you drive a newer model car with advanced safety features, your estimate may be lower compared to an older model with higher risk factors. Local driving conditions in Burnet County, such as traffic patterns and accident statistics, can influence your car insurance estimate. For instance, if you frequently navigate the winding roads around Lake Buchanan, your risk profile may differ from someone driving mainly in more urban areas like Burnet itself. It's also worth noting that seasonal changes, like the influx of tourists during summer, can affect traffic and accident rates, which may impact your estimates.
- Rate Quotes: Rate quotes represent the final pricing you receive from an insurance company after they evaluate your risk profile. This evaluation includes not just your personal driving history, but also broader statistics relevant to Burnet County, such as local crime rates and the frequency of claims in the area. By understanding how these factors contribute to your rate, you can better negotiate and seek competitive offers from multiple insurers. For example, if there has been an uptick in accidents on Highway 281, this could impact the rates offered by insurers, underscoring the importance of staying informed about local driving conditions. It's advisable to request multiple quotes and compare them, as different insurers may weigh risk factors differently, leading to varying rates for the same coverage.
- Premium Estimations: This refers to the amount you will pay for your insurance policy, calculated on a monthly or annual basis. It's important to note that premiums can vary significantly based on your coverage choices, deductibles, and any discounts you may qualify for, such as safe driver discounts or multi-policy discounts. For residents in Burnet County, being aware of available discounts can help in reducing your overall premium costs. For instance, if you have completed a defensive driving course, you may be eligible for a discount that could significantly lower your premium. Bundling your auto insurance with home insurance from the same provider can lead to further savings. Understanding your specific needs and how they align with the discounts offered can be a game-changer in your premium estimation process.
- Auto Insurance Proposals: These formal offers from insurance companies detail the coverage options and pricing available to you. When reviewing proposals, pay attention to the specifics of coverage limits, exclusions, and the claims process. For instance, if you frequently travel on rural roads in Burnet County, you may want to prioritize comprehensive coverage that addresses potential hazards specific to those areas, such as wildlife crossings or severe weather conditions. Understanding the claims process can help you navigate any future incidents more effectively, ensuring you know what to expect and how quickly you can access support. Don’t hesitate to ask your insurer for clarifications on any points that are unclear in the proposal, as a thorough understanding can prevent surprises later on.

How to Get the Best Auto Insurance Quotes
To ensure you receive the best auto insurance quotes in Burnet County, TX, consider the following tips:
- Gather Your Information: Have your driver's license, vehicle details, and any previous insurance information ready to provide accurate data for your quotes.
- Compare Multiple Quotes: Don’t settle for the first quote you receive. Comparing multiple options can often lead to significant savings.
- Inquire About Discounts: Many insurance carriers offer discounts for safe driving, bundling policies, or even for being a member of certain organizations.
- Review Coverage Options: Ensure that you understand the coverage limits and deductibles, as these factors will influence your premium costs.
